Windows.Devices.Enumeration 命名空间
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
提供用于枚举设备的类。 以下是 Windows.Devices.Enumeration API 的典型用法。
- 生成用于选择要由应用程序使用的设备的用户界面。 例如,语音聊天应用程序可能会提供麦克风或网络摄像头列表供用户选择,或者照片导入应用程序可能会提供可移动存储设备的列表,以便用户从中导入照片。
- 获取有关系统连接到或可由系统发现的设备的常规信息。
- 设备发现和有关使用它们的应用的设备的通知。
类
DeviceAccessChangedEventArgs |
为 AccessChanged 事件提供数据。 |
DeviceAccessInformation |
包含有关访问设备的信息。 |
DeviceConnectionChangeTriggerDetails |
提供有关导致此触发器触发的设备的信息。 |
DeviceDisconnectButtonClickedEventArgs |
为 DevicePicker 对象上的 DisconnectButtonClicked 事件提供数据。 |
DeviceInformation |
表示设备。 此类允许访问已知的设备属性,以及设备枚举期间指定的其他属性。 |
DeviceInformationCollection |
表示 DeviceInformation 对象的集合。 |
DeviceInformationCustomPairing |
表示 DeviceInformation 对象的自定义配对。 |
DeviceInformationPairing |
包含信息并启用设备的配对。 |
DeviceInformationUpdate |
包含 DeviceInformation 对象的更新属性。 |
DevicePairingRequestedEventArgs |
为 PairingRequested 事件提供数据。 |
DevicePairingResult |
包含有关尝试配对设备的结果的信息。 |
DevicePairingSetMembersRequestedEventArgs |
提供用于枚举设备的类。 以下是 Windows.Devices.Enumeration API 的典型用法。
|
DevicePicker |
表示选取器浮出控件,其中包含可供用户选择的设备列表。 在桌面应用中,在以显示 UI 的方式使用此类的实例之前,需要将该对象与其所有者的窗口句柄相关联。 有关详细信息和代码示例,请参阅 显示依赖于 CoreWindow 的 WinRT UI 对象。 |
DevicePickerAppearance |
表示设备选取器的外观。 |
DevicePickerFilter |
表示用于确定在设备选取器中显示的设备的筛选器。 将筛选器参数组合在一起,以生成生成的筛选器。 |
DeviceSelectedEventArgs |
为 DevicePicker 对象上的 DeviceSelected 事件提供数据。 |
DeviceThumbnail |
表示设备的缩略图图像。 |
DeviceUnpairingResult |
包含有关尝试取消设备配对的结果的信息。 |
DeviceWatcher |
动态枚举设备,以便在初始枚举完成后添加、删除或更改设备时,应用会收到通知。 |
DeviceWatcherEvent |
在初始枚举完成后更新设备列表时触发。 |
DeviceWatcherTriggerDetails |
提供有关调用触发器的设备更新的详细信息。 |
EnclosureLocation |
描述设备在其机箱中的物理位置。 |
接口
IDeviceEnumerationSettings |
提供用于枚举设备的类。 以下是 Windows.Devices.Enumeration API 的典型用法。
|
IDevicePairingSettings |
标识设备配对的设置集合。 WiFiDirectConnectionParameters 实现 IDevicePairingSettings。 |
枚举
DeviceAccessStatus |
指示访问设备的状态。 |
DeviceClass |
指示用户要枚举的设备类型。 |
DeviceInformationKind |
表示 DeviceInformation 对象的类型。 |
DevicePairingAddPairingSetMemberStatus |
提供用于枚举设备的类。 以下是 Windows.Devices.Enumeration API 的典型用法。
|
DevicePairingKinds |
指示应用程序支持或系统请求的配对类型。 作为输入值,使用此值指示应用程序支持的配对类型。 当此数据类型作为输出值接收时,它指示系统请求的配对类型。 在这种情况下,代码需要做出相应的响应。 |
DevicePairingProtectionLevel |
配对的保护级别。 |
DevicePairingResultStatus |
与关联终结点的配对操作的结果 (AEP) 设备对象。 有关 AEP 对象的详细信息,请参阅 DeviceInformationKind。 |
DevicePickerDisplayStatusOptions |
指示你希望设备选取器显示有关给定设备的内容。 与 DevicePicker 对象上的 SetDisplayStatus 方法一起使用。 |
DeviceUnpairingResultStatus |
取消配对操作的结果。 |
DeviceWatcherEventKind |
事件的类型。 |
DeviceWatcherStatus |
描述 DeviceWatcher 对象的状态。 |
Panel |
指示面板在计算机上的位置。 此枚举用于指示设备的物理位置。 |
另请参阅
反馈
https://aka.ms/ContentUserFeedback。
即将推出:在整个 2024 年,我们将逐步取消以“GitHub 问题”作为内容的反馈机制,并将其替换为新的反馈系统。 有关详细信息,请参阅:提交和查看相关反馈